1. It is very difficult living with an ADHD child.
2. Their constant activity, noise, etc. is annoying.
3. Their short attention span is frustrating. .
4. Their interrupting, calling out, and inappropriate/potentially dangerous behaviour is upsetting.
5. Homework time is a struggle/battle.
6. You see how different your child's behaviour is when compared to other children of the same age.
7. Teachers complain about your child's classroom behaviour/
incompletion of tasks.
8. Do you avoid contact with your child's teacher because you are tired of the endless complaints.
9. Neighbours call to tell you what your child did.
10. Your other children/relative's children are angry with the ADHD child and wanyou to "make him/her stop".
11. Your other children/relatives feel embarrassed to bring their friends home because the ADHD child will start acting out.
12. You feel lost because you also do not understand your child's behaviour.
13. You often get angry and frustrated with your ADHD child.
14. Do you and your spouse disagree on how to deal with your ADHD child, e.g. one favours punishment and the other is
permissive and understanding.
YES NO 15. Do you or your spouse try to withdraw from confronting
these problems by using work as an excuse
16. Do you or your spouse make excuses not to be home in the evenings.
17. Do you or your spouse blame each other for all the problems in your home.
18. Do you or your spouse clash with each other unnecessarily.
19. Do you feel your family doctor who is treating your ADHD
child, is not really helping. .
20. Do other family members, eg. grandparents, insist that you be more strict with your ADHD child.
21. Do you avoid social situations, eg. shopping, restaurants, etc. because you do not want to be embarrassed by your ADHD child.
22. Do you feel everything is becoming too much and nobody understands, nor can they help you.
23. Is the cost of medication for your child's ADHD an added financial burden.
24. Has your entire life been turned upside down because of your ADHD child and you feel that you sometimes need some ti me-out.
.
25. Do you feel that you are not getting enough sleep or proper meals because of your ever demanding ADHD child.
